PEOPLE PUSH TAXI CAB OUT OF SNOW BANK IN NEW YORK DURING WINTER STORM.
People push a stranded taxi cab out of a snow bank in Times Square in
New York City, February 17, 2003 as a winter storm hit the northeast
United States. The storm was expected to leave 18 to 22 inches of snow
in New York City, which had 1,300 plows and 148,000 tons of salt ready
to clear streets. REUTERS/Mike Segar
